Handover note — Crumbwheel order cutoffs.

Welcome aboard. The bakery cutoff rule in Crumbwheel closes same-day orders at 14:00 local to each storefront, not UTC — this has bitten us twice. Holiday overrides live in the calendar service and take precedence silently, so always check there first when a cutoff looks wrong. To unlock the calendar service's admin console after a restart, enter the recovery passphrase below.

vault phrase of bagap-bahaf = silion-pelox-sorox-casdor-quenwyn-fraax-eliox-praael-kelion-quenvan-kasox-rusael-norius-belvan

# Service Accounts for Pixelhoard Plugins

Hey plugin folks — quick note on the image cache leak in Pixelhoard 2.8. Cached bitmaps held by your plugin's service account aren't freed until the account session closes, so long-lived sessions slowly eat memory. Workaround: recycle your session every few hours, or pin cache size via the Snapvault admin API. You'll need a scoped service-account key to hit that endpoint, shown below.

service key, tadup-tahog: zpat7_wB1tnEL

# Welcome to FlagForge

Hey, glad you're aboard! FlagForge is our homegrown feature-flag rollout framework — it gates every risky change behind percentage ramps so we can chicken out gracefully. Your local setup needs the control-plane credential before the SDK will fetch flag configs; without it everything silently falls back to defaults and you'll think your flags are broken. Grab one from the vault tool, then paste this line into your `.env` to connect.

vault entry, yahif-yajep: COURIER_KEY29=b802bdf8034096b65a51c6ba5abe2